For example, consider a weapon that does 50-55 air damage. You can reforge onto the weapon one of Larian's "_Weapon_Damage_Air" boosts, which will add some air damage. The boost will add another ~4 air damage, bringing the weapon to 54-59. This boost can be reforged off if you use a different augment like Ranger. You can reforge multiple damage boosts onto the weapon, but you can't reforge the same boost. If you reforge "_Weapon_Damage_Air_Large" onto the weapon, you need to reforge "_Weapon_Damage_Air_Small" next.
Uniques won't have damage boosts rolled onto them unless the unique already has a boost (pretty rare).
The reforge system assigns a point value to each boost based on several factors. So if you want a lot of high-damage reforges, then you need a weapon that comes with many high-value boosts already.
Uniques are reforged differently because they don't typically have boosts. Assigned stats on the item, like Aerotheurge or TwoHanded, are reforged instead. Randomly generated items usually won't have assigned stats since they rely on boosts for their stats instead.
Specifically for "Sets Shocked", this is part of many Larian boosts that share the name "_Weapon_Damage_Air", which adds some air damage and a chance to Shock. These can be added via a Mage augment, which looks for boosts that have "_Damage_Air" in the name.
